Job Responsibilities:
- Stress Lab Operations: Prepare patients for and conduct cardiac stress tests (including treadmill/exercise and pharmacological tests). Monitor patient safety, interpret EKG changes during peak stress, and assist providers in identifying diagnostic indicators.
- Cardiac Rehabilitation: Assess, plan, implement, and evaluate individualized nursing care for patients participating in cardiac rehabilitation programs.
- Clinical Monitoring: Monitor patients during both stress testing and exercise sessions—including continuous EKG/rhythm monitoring, vital signs, symptom assessment, and physiological response to activity—responding immediately to clinical changes or emergencies.
- Patient Education: Provide comprehensive education related to cardiac health, diagnostic procedures, risk factor reduction, exercise, nutrition, medications, and lifestyle modification.
- Collaboration: Work closely with cardiologists, rehab staff, and interdisciplinary team members to support diagnostic findings, treatment plans, and continuity of care.
- Documentation: Maintain accurate, timely documentation of assessments, stress test results, nursing interventions, and patient progress within the electronic health record in accordance with organizational and regulatory standards.
- Safety & Compliance: Maintain a safe, sterile, and therapeutic environment while promoting high-quality clinical outcomes, regulatory compliance, and a positive, supportive patient experience.
